Live Oaks School Unveils "Under the Sea" Sensory Pathway

We are thrilled to announce the grand unveiling of our Under the Sea themed Sensory Pathway at Live Oaks School! This incredible initiative, started by our second grade teachers, was two years in the making. It was made possible through the generous donation from the Guido Family. 

We extend our heartfelt gratitude to Raymond Guido and his sisters—Peg Hawes, Anne Marie Hogan, Alice Guido, and Judy Guido—for their support in bringing this vision to life. They supported this meaningful initiative in honor of the relationships Mr. Guido’s late mother had with his son. A plaque beside the pathway commemorates this generous gift, reading:
"In Loving Memory of Mary (Marie) Gloria Guido. Donated by the Guido Family in her memory."

The Sensory Pathway is designed to benefit all Live Oaks students, offering movement breaks to help regulate emotions, improve motor skills, and enhance focus in the classroom. This engaging space will provide students with the opportunity to release energy in a structured, beneficial way, fostering a more effective learning environment.
